Synopsis

A toy stuffed dog is freshly sewn together when it overhears a young child asking for an orange. The child's mother explains that they cannot afford to buy one. The dog is then placed in a box with other toys for sale, but eventually ends up abandoned on the street. Picking up an orange from a sidewalk stand, the dog decides to return it to the child. However, before it can reach the child's home, it must endure a series of strange and frightening adventures.
